The YMCA of Simcoe/Muskoka is delighted to once again receive the support of Zehrs’ Give a Little, Help a Lot campaign to assist children in Simcoe/Muskoka. The campaign invites members of the community to support healthy, active living opportunities for children by donating to the YMCA.

From July 27 to Aug. 9, Zehrs Markets stores in Ontario invites shoppers to Give a Little, Help a Lot by adding $2 to their grocery bill in support of the YMCA. All funds collected from the Alliston, Big Bay Point, Bradford, Duckworth, Essa Road and Orillia stores will provide the financial assistance to allow kids in Simcoe/Muskoka to participate in health-focused YMCA programs like day camps, after-school programs, sports and swimming through health and fitness memberships.

“The Give a Little, Help a Lot campaign enables children, no matter their financial circumstances, to attend the Y to get active, learn new skills, gain confidence and make new friends,” says Brian Shelley, vice president, Philanthropy, Brand and Community Development, YMCA of Simcoe/Muskoka.

“We’re asking our community members to help create these meaningful and important development experiences for children by donating to support YMCA programs.”

For nine years, Zehrs Markets and their parent company, Loblaw Companies Limited, have been working with the YMCA to create opportunities for children to become healthier, and reach their full potential. The YMCA has always advocated for and supported the development of happy and healthy children, and the support of the community continues to help make this possible.
